Yeah? You think that's bad? Try losing your license for drinking in BC.

You're looking at a $500 reinstatement fee. $700 30-day impound plus tow. Interlock system installed in any vehicle you drive (including for work - explain that to your boss) which costs hundreds of dollars each month for any period they want to put you through it (usually six months). A safe-driving course that costs $900. And if you can't afford the impound fees, they apply to have your vehicle crushed, sue you for the amount owing, and then apply for you to never be able to get insurance on any vehicle or your license back again, nation-wide. Ever. Over a fucking towing company not getting their $600+ impound fees from you. Try doing all that while on disability. You're fucked. The punishment should fit the crime and monetary penalties need to be removed, otherwise the police may as well start carrying debit machines.
